Consider Your Budget

Another crucial aspect to consider when choosing a home in Katy, Texas is your budget. This will not only determine the type and size of home you can afford, but also the location. Properties closer to the city center or with higher-end amenities may come with a higher price tag. It's important to not only consider the initial cost of the home, but also potential future expenses such as property tax and homeowners association fees.

Think About Your Needs and Wants

Before starting your home search, it's important to make a list of your needs and wants. This could include things like the number of bedrooms, a backyard for pets or children, a specific school district, or a certain style of home. Having a clear idea of your non-negotiables and your desired features will help narrow down your search and find the perfect home for you and your family.
